What is a Digital Modeller?
A Digital Modeller is a professional who creates high-quality 3D models for industries such as automotive design, gaming, film, and product development. Using software like Autodesk Alias, Blender, Maya, or CATIA, they translate sketches, CAD data, and concept designs into precise digital representations. These models serve as the foundation for visualisation, prototyping, and production, making digital modellers essential in sectors where aesthetics and functionality converge.
Skills Required for Digital Modeller Jobs
A successful digital modeller needs a combination of technical expertise, artistic sensibility, and problem-solving abilities. Key skills include:
3D Modelling Proficiency – Strong expertise in software such as Autodesk Alias, Rhino, Maya, ZBrush, and Blender is essential for creating complex digital models.
Attention to Detail – Precision is crucial, as digital modellers must produce models that meet industry specifications and client requirements.
Knowledge of Design Principles – A solid understanding of shape, form, and aesthetics is essential, particularly in automotive and product design.
Collaboration Skills – Digital modellers work closely with designers, engineers, and animators, requiring excellent communication and teamwork.
Problem-Solving Ability – They must be able to identify design challenges and propose practical solutions that align with production requirements.
Understanding of Manufacturing Processes – In industries like automotive and industrial design, familiarity with production techniques (such as CNC machining and 3D printing) helps ensure models are manufacturable.
Day-to-Day Responsibilities of a Digital Modeller
The daily work of a digital modeller varies depending on the industry, but common responsibilities include:
Creating 3D Models – Translating 2D sketches, CAD data, or concept drawings into high-quality, detailed digital models.
Refining Designs – Iterating on models based on feedback from designers, engineers, or animators, ensuring accuracy and aesthetic appeal.
Rendering and Visualisation – Producing photorealistic renders to help stakeholders visualise the final product before production.
Collaboration with Teams – Engaging in discussions with design teams, engineers, and other stakeholders to refine model details and ensure feasibility.
Data Management – Organising and maintaining 3D files, ensuring models are correctly structured for integration into workflows such as CGI, animation, or manufacturing.
Keeping Up with Industry Trends – Staying updated on the latest software developments, modelling techniques, and emerging technologies like AI-driven design tools.
Career Progression for Digital Modellers
Digital modelling offers an exciting career path with various opportunities for advancement. Typically, professionals start as Junior Digital Modellers, working under experienced designers. With experience, they can progress to Mid-Level or Senior Digital Modeller roles, where they take on more responsibility in leading projects and mentoring junior staff.
Beyond this, career paths can diverge based on interests and industry focus:
Lead Modeller / Principal Modeller – Overseeing teams and driving the creative direction of digital modelling projects.
Design Manager – Transitioning into a leadership role, managing design teams and workflows.
Technical Specialist – Focusing on developing innovative digital modelling techniques, including advanced surface modelling or AI-assisted workflows.
Visualisation Artist or CGI Specialist – Moving into animation, gaming, or film, where digital models are used for high-end rendering and effects.
Freelance or Consultancy Roles – Offering expertise to multiple industries, from automotive brands to product design firms.
